Alert thresholds allow you to define specific conditions that trigger notifications.
By setting appropriate thresholds, you can ensure timely alerts for events such as speeding, idling, low battery or authorized hours.
Tailor alert thresholds around specific groups to suit your operational needs.

Alert Settings
- Log in to your Customer Portal and click ‘Setup’ from the top toolbar.
- Select ‘Alert Settings’ from the left menu.
NOTE: ‘Alert Settings’ is where you update your Time Zone.

- Once you are on Alert Settings you will see both General Settings and Authorized Hours.
- General Settings
- Set thresholds and toggle alerts based on your preferences.
- Update your time zone.
- Tip! Hover over the question marks to see a description of each setting.
- Click ‘SAVE CHANGES’ to set your preferences.
- Authorized Hours
- Set the hours of the day the vehicles are authorized to drive.
- If a vehicle is driven outside of these defined hours the trip will be considered “unauthorized.”
- You can choose different hours based on different Groups.
- Click ‘SAVE CHANGES’ to set your hours.
